Question 1081902: Juan is going to rent a truck for one day. There are two companies he can choose from, and they have the following prices. Company A charges $92 and allows unlimited mileage. Company B has an initial fee of $65 and charges an additional $0.90 for every mile driven.
For what mileages will Company A charge less than Company B? Use m for the number of miles driven, and solve your inequality for m.
